- Einpreß-Steckverbinder zum Einpressen in Bohrungen einer Leiterplatte bei dem L-förmige Kontakte (3) mit einem Schenkel des L in einem im wesentlichen quaderförmigen Kunststoffkörper (1) durch Einpressen befestigt und mit dem anderen rechtwinklig zur Leiterplatte hin abgebogenen Schenkel des L in einem Preßteil (2) in schlitzartigen, zur Leiterplatte hin offenen Aussparungen (4) seitlich geführt sind und an ihrem freien Ende einen Einpreßabschnitt (5) aufweisen, der jeweils mit zwei Einpreßschultern (6) versehen ist, wobei das Preßteil (2) mit zur Leiterplatte parallelen, neben den Aussparungen (4) angeordneten Einpreßflächen (7) ausgebildet ist, die beim Einpressen mit den Einpreßschultern (6) zusammenwirken, und bei der das Steckgesicht des Steckverbinders durch ein Schirmblech (8) gebildet ist, dessen zur Leiterplatte senkrechte Teile (9) eine Frontebene des Steckverbinders definieren,
dadurch gekennzeichnet, daßdas Preßteil (2) annähernd U-förmig ausgebildet ist,die freien Enden (14, 15) der U-Schenkel zusammen mit dem dazwischen angeordneten Kunststoffkörper (1) an die Frontebene anstoßen,die U-Basis als Druckfläche (11) beim Einpressen vorgesehen istund daß an den U-Schenkeln leiterplattenseitig jeweils ein gegenüber der Frontebene zurückversetzter Befestigungszapfen (16) angeformt ist. - Einpreß-Steckverbinder nach Anspruch 1,
dadurch gekennzeichnet, daß
für jeden U-Schenkel ein annähernd Z-förmiges Masseübertragungsblech (10) vorgesehen ist, dessen kurzer Schenkel senkrecht und dessen langer Schenkel parallel zur Leiterplatte verlaufen, wobei der erste kurze Schenkel zwischen dem freien Ende (14, 15) des U-Schenkels und dem Schirmblech (8) eingelegt ist, während der zweite kurze Schenkel als Leiterplattenanschlußclip (21) ausgebildet und zwischen den beiden Hälften des geschlitzt ausgeführten Befestigungszapfens (16) angeordnet ist.
